HR Corporate Leadership Expert
HR Corporate Leadership Expert

HR Corporate Leadership Expert

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
M

At a Glance

  • Tasks: Lead global HR initiatives to shape leadership development and enhance talent strategies.
  • Company: Join Munich Re, a top reinsurance company transforming risk into opportunity with over 11,000 employees worldwide.
  • Benefits: Enjoy diverse benefits including career mobility, continuous learning, and a culture that values inclusion.
  • Why this job: Be part of a dynamic team driving innovation and making a meaningful impact on future challenges.
  • Qualifications: Bachelor's degree in HR or related field; 3+ years in leadership development; strong analytical skills required.
  • Other info: Remote work options available; apply online with your CV and a cover letter.

The predicted salary is between 36000 - 60000 £ per year.

Working in Global HR at Munich Re for Reinsurance & Specialty Group means being part of a dynamic, globally connected team that plays a critical role in shaping the future of our organization. As an HR professional, you contribute to the success of our business by supporting people strategies that drive transformation, foster collaboration, and enable sustainable growth.

Our Global HR function is evolving to meet th e needs of a fast-changing world. We operate in a connected, collaborative, and forward-thinking Global HR matrix community that values empathy, initiative, and a global mindset—where every team member plays a role in delivering effective services and solutions and creating meaningful impact.

Whether your focus is talent, rewards, analytics, business partnering, services, or any other area of HR, you will work across regions and functions to co-create solutions that support our people and business. You will be empowered to collaborate, innovate, and grow—contributing to a culture that values diversity, continuous learning, and shared success.

Join us in building the future of Global HR.

YOUR JOB

  • Analyze companywide leadership offerings and harmonize them globally. Implement global leadership framework in alignment with our future Munich Re strategy.
  • Conceptualize and define a leadership career path with various stakeholders for career orientation.
  • Design and create offerings for identified talents interested in the leadership career path but not yet in leadership positions for role change preparation purposes.
  • Design a leadership program for first time leaders and ensure the global implementation together with Talent Development & Learning experts in the regions.
  • Support the internal leadership feedback process for continuous conversation with communication and enabling measures.
  • Ensure the availability of diagnostic measurements like personality tests and 360 degree feedback to identify and develop talents and to implement these measures into trainings, programs and coachings for their further development.
  • Design and develop a global framework for coaching offerings for different target groups. Identify the needed technology, implement a modern coaching platform, design a coaching framework and process with external vendors.
  • Continuously assess the effectiveness of learning programs and initiatives, gathering feedback from participants and key stakeholders to identify areas for improvement and implementing enhancements to optimize learning outcomes.
  • Keep abreast of the latest trends and best practices in leadership development, regularly conducting research to stay current with innovative approaches and technologies.
  • Collaborate closely with the other global and regional learning experts regarding academy offerings and marketing, digital learning offerings, skills approach or expert career paths.
  • Furthermore, support other important strategic talent and leadership projects closely linked to our Munich Re and overall HR Strategy and collaborate with other experts, stakeholders and our management.

YOUR PROFILE

  • A bachelor’s degree or equivalent in human resources, organizational development, education, or a related field. A master’s degree is preferred; a coaching certification is a plus.
  • At least 3 years of experience in leadership development, preferably in a global or multinational context.
  • Strong conceptual, analytical and strategical skills.
  • Ability to understand and simplify complexity and operationalize ideas with lean processes in a smart way.
  • Knowledge of adult learning principles, instructional design methodologies, and new techniques.
  • Experience in using digital platforms (LMS, LXP) and other tools to design, deliver and analyze engaging and effective learning solutions.
  • Excellent communication skills in English, interpersonal skills, with the ability to work effectively with diverse stakeholders across cultures and geographies.
  • A proactive, creative, innovative, and collaborative mindset, with a passion for continuous improvement and excellence.

Application Instructions

Please apply through our online portal and upload your CV. We recommend writing a cover letter to tell us more about why the position and Munich Re is of interest to you.

About us

As the world\’s leading reinsurance company with more than 11,000 employees at over 50 locations, Munich Re introduces a paradigm shift in the way you think about insurance. By turning uncertainty into a manageable risk we enable fundamental change. Join us working on topics today that will concern society tomorrow, whether that be climate change, major construction projects, medical risk assessment or even space travel.

Together we embrace a culture where multiskilled teams dare to think big. We create the new and the different for our clients and cultivate innovation.

Sounds like you? Push boundaries with us and be part of Munich Re.

Our employees are our greatest strength. That’s why we offer them a wide range of benefits. You can find some examples below.

Unlock your potential

  • Diversity, Equity & Inclusion: we embrace the power of differences and are convinced that diversity fosters innovation and resilience and enables us to act braver and better.
  • Continuous Learning: we believe that continuous learning is a key differentiator and critical for building new skills and accelerating growth.
  • Career Mobility: we actively support career mobility, and our strong global and regional presence offers a wealth of career growth opportunities for you.

* Munich Re not only stands for fairness with regard to its clients; it is also an equal opportunities employer. Severely disabled candidates will also be prioritized, if equally qualified.

#J-18808-Ljbffr

HR Corporate Leadership Expert employer: Munich Re

Munich Re is an exceptional employer that champions a culture of diversity, continuous learning, and career mobility, making it an ideal place for HR professionals looking to make a meaningful impact. With a globally connected team and a commitment to innovation, employees are empowered to collaborate and grow within a dynamic environment that values empathy and initiative. Join us in shaping the future of Global HR while enjoying a wealth of benefits and opportunities for personal and professional development in a forward-thinking organisation.
M

Contact Detail:

Munich Re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land HR Corporate Leadership Expert

✨Tip Number 1

Familiarise yourself with Munich Re's leadership development initiatives and their global HR strategy. Understanding their current offerings and future direction will help you align your experience and ideas with their needs during discussions.

✨Tip Number 2

Network with current or former employees of Munich Re, especially those in HR or leadership roles. Engaging in conversations can provide valuable insights into the company culture and expectations, which can be beneficial when discussing your fit for the role.

✨Tip Number 3

Stay updated on the latest trends in leadership development and coaching methodologies. Being able to discuss innovative approaches and how they could be applied at Munich Re will demonstrate your proactive mindset and commitment to continuous improvement.

✨Tip Number 4

Prepare to showcase your analytical and strategic skills by thinking of examples where you've simplified complex processes or implemented effective learning solutions. This will help you illustrate your capability to operationalise ideas in a smart way during interviews.

We think you need these skills to ace HR Corporate Leadership Expert

Leadership Development
Global HR Strategy
Analytical Skills
Conceptual Thinking
Instructional Design
Adult Learning Principles
Digital Learning Platforms (LMS, LXP)
Stakeholder Engagement
Communication Skills
Coaching Framework Development
Feedback Mechanisms
Continuous Improvement
Research Skills
Collaboration Skills
Project Management

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in leadership development and HR. Use keywords from the job description to demonstrate that you understand the role and its requirements.

Craft a Compelling Cover Letter: In your cover letter, express your passion for the position and Munich Re. Discuss how your background aligns with their values of collaboration, innovation, and continuous learning.

Showcase Your Skills: Emphasise your analytical and strategic skills in your application. Provide examples of how you've simplified complex processes or implemented effective learning solutions in previous roles.

Research and Reflect: Familiarise yourself with Munich Re's culture and recent initiatives in leadership development. Reflect on how your experiences can contribute to their goals and mention this in your application.

How to prepare for a job interview at Munich Re

✨Understand the Global HR Landscape

Familiarise yourself with the dynamics of global HR, especially in a multinational context. Be prepared to discuss how you can contribute to shaping people strategies that drive transformation and foster collaboration.

✨Showcase Your Leadership Development Experience

Highlight your experience in leadership development, particularly any global initiatives you've been part of. Be ready to share specific examples of how you've implemented leadership frameworks or programmes in previous roles.

✨Demonstrate Analytical Skills

Prepare to discuss how you analyse and simplify complex ideas. Think of examples where you've operationalised concepts into effective processes, especially in relation to leadership development and training.

✨Emphasise Continuous Learning and Innovation

Express your passion for continuous improvement and staying current with trends in leadership development. Share any innovative approaches or technologies you've used in your previous roles to enhance learning outcomes.

HR Corporate Leadership Expert
Munich Re

Land your dream job quicker with Premium

Your application goes to the top of the list
Personalised CV feedback that lands interviews
Support from real people with tickets
Apply for more jobs in less time with AI support
Go Premium

Money-back if you don't land a job in 6-months

M
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>